CoinMarketCap (CMC) is the industry's most recognized cryptocurrency data aggregator, serving as the de facto standard for tracking prices, market capitalizations, and trading volumes across thousands of digital assets. Acquired by Binance in 2020, CMC offers comprehensive market data, historical charts, exchange rankings, and an extensive coin listing directory that remains unmatched in breadth. Its API provides robust access to real-time and historical data across free and paid tiers, making it a go-to resource for developers and researchers. The platform's toplists"including trending coins, gainers/losers, and market cap rankings"are widely referenced across the industry. Strengths include its massive dataset, intuitive interface, educational content (CMC Alexandria), and community features like portfolio tracking. Concerns center around potential conflicts of interest due to Binance ownership, occasional discrepancies in reported exchange volumes, and the free API tier's rate limitations. Despite these caveats, CoinMarketCap remains an essential tool in any crypto enthusiast's arsenal, offering unparalleled market coverage and data accessibility.

CoinMarketCap remains a go‑to for crypto market intelligence. Its stats cover thousands of assets and exchanges with liquidity‑adjusted volumes, dominance metrics, categories, and deep historical charts. Data is generally timely and reliable, though micro‑caps can lag and the interface can feel busy. For developers, the REST API is robust and well‑documented, with endpoints for quotes, market pairs, metadata, and OHLCV; uptime is solid. The free tier is adequate for prototypes, but tighter rate limits and paywalls on richer history/precision push serious use to paid plans. Toplists shine for discovery"gainers/losers, newly listed, sector and chain filters"while clearly marking sponsored items. Overall, a mature, comprehensive resource.
